Scientist 1

 

Description:


We are looking for an enthusiastic and motivated individual for this Scientist 1 position within the Core Services Library Prep Lab to help run day to day operations. Our ideal candidate will work cross functionally with the team and other groups sharing and using their knowledge of molecular biology, Next Generation Sequencing libraries and Illumina library prep and liquid handler automation.
